Gin Gold 999.9 is homage to a gin created in the early 20th century which was said to have been made in a pot still made of gold! This expression has been made in Alsace with a selection of botanicals that includes juniper, almond, vanilla, cassia bark, gentian violet, poppy, tangerine, coriander, violet flowers and angelica root. - Nose: A complex mix of juniper, tangerine, fresh flowers (like violet and poppy), and balsamic notes from spices and almonds.
- Palate: Starts with fresh, citrus notes (especially tangerine), moves to a tapestry of floral and spicy flavors, and finishes with subtle notes of almond and vanilla.
- Finish: A long, well-balanced finish with hints of juniper, tangerine, and almond.
- Botanicals: Includes juniper, tangerine, ginger, coriander, violet, poppy, and vanilla.
- Flavor profile: A bold, fruity, and spicy gin that is less heavy on juniper than traditional gins, making it a good option for those who prefer a less juniper-forward drink.
- Appearance: A golden-colored gin with a gold-flecked liquid in a distinctive golden bottle, inspired by historical gold stills.
- Best served: Ideal for sipping neat, with a splash of tonic and a lemon twist, or used as a unique base for cocktails like a Negroni.
